Brendan Murtagh BA (Hons), MSc, PhD, MRTPI, MIPI, ILTM

Background

Dr. Murtagh is a Chartered Town Planner and previously worked in community planning and research in a number of private consultancies before joining the Housing Executive as a Senior Economist in 1989.  He was appointed as a Lecture in Housing at the University of Ulster in 1994 before joining The Queen’s University of Belfast as a Reader in 2000.

 

Teaching

 

Dr Murtaghs teaching includes research methods, community planning, introduction to spatial planning and planning practice at both postgraduate and undergraduate levels.

 

Administration

 

Dr Murtagh is module coordinator of 4 courses on the postgraduate and undergraduate courses is responsible for the ISEP website and sits on the Universities Research Ethics Committee.  He also sits on the EU LEADER + Programme Monitoring Committee for Northern Ireland.
